Uncover the truth about authoritarian parenting in Parents Who Bully. Through compelling real-life accounts and authoritative research, you'll gain invaluable insights into the signs of emotionally abusive parents. Understand the lasting impact of authoritarian parenting styles, and discover the path to healing and emotional freedom. This eye-opening book empowers you to confront the turmoil and scars caused by parental emotional abuse, offering a guide to recovery and personal transformation.

Are you ready to break free from the chains of the authoritarian personality? Parents Who Bully equips you with the tools to recognize and overcome the toxic dynamics of your family. With expert guidance, you'll learn how to deal with emotionally abusive parents, heal your emotional wounds, and ultimately find relief and empowerment.

In this book, you'll find: in-depth insights into emotionally abusive parents and their impact on adult children; authoritative research and real-life accounts that demonstrate the signs of toxic parenting styles; practical strategies to break free from bad parents and heal deep emotional wounds; and a comprehensive roadmap for understanding, recovery, and personal growth in the face of parental emotional abuse.

Author Bio: Eric Maisel

Author Bio: Eric Maisel

Eric Maisel, widely regarded as America’s foremost creativity coach, is the author of more than forty books. In addition to training creativity coaches, leading workshops nationally and internationally, and maintaining an individual creativity coaching practice, Dr. Maisel is in the forefront of the movement to rethink mental health. His books have been translated into more than a dozen languages, he has conducted hundreds of interviews, and his print column Coaching the Artist Within appears monthly in Professional Artist magazine.
